WebJan 3, 2013 · A lyrical debut novel about innocence and experience, class and consumerism, Clay captures the delicate balance of life in the city, between young and old, between nature and development, between recklessness and caution. Publisher: Bloomsbury Publishing Plc ISBN: 9781408826027 Number of pages: 272 Weight: 412 g …
